While **Nokia X** was launched last month for Rs 8,599, the XL and X+ were likely to **reach Indian shores by May** . Now, the company is all set to showcase the Nokia XL, and has sent out invites for events in Delhi and Mumbai to be held on May 1 and May 3, respectively. The invite states ‘Fastlane to your Android Apps’ along with #GoNokiaXL, clearly hinting that the company plans to bring the XL to India soon. However, there is no mention of the X+. Take a look at the invite below:  The Nokia XL sports a 5-inch display with 480 x 800 pixels of resolution, and is powered by a dual-core Snapdragon processor that clocks at 1GHz. It comes equipped with a 5 megapixel rear camera and a 2-megapixel front-facing camera for Skype calls and selfies. Its 4GB onboard storage can be expanded further up to 32GB via microSD card slot. The connectivity options include Wi-Fi, Bluetooth and GPS with A-GPS. It runs Android, but the login and app data is said to be tied to Microsoft’s cloud services, and not Google as in any other Android phone. The phones run a version of Android Open Source Project, with access to sideloading of apps, third-party app stores and Nokia’s own store. You will find Microsoft essentials instead of Google services.
